(Singapore).- Las Vegas Sands marked a momentous milestone onTuesday 15 July 2025 with the groundbreaking of its newUS$8 billion ultra-luxurious resort and entertainmentdestination in Singapore, expanding its regional footprint andstrengthening its commitment to the Republic's future.

The development includes a 15,000-seat state-of-the-art arena being designed by global design firm Populous. Specially created to host the highest calibre of regional and international touring acts, concerts and large-scale live events, the venue will be optimised for unparalleled acoustics, sightlines and production flexibility.

The groundbreaking event was officiated by Singapore’s Prime Minister and Minister for Finance Lawrence Wong; Minister for Sustainability and the Environment and Minister-in-charge of Trade Relations Grace Fu; and Las Vegas Sands co-founder Dr Miriam Adelson, Chairman and Chief Executive Officer Robert Goldstein, and President and Chief Operating Officer Patrick Dumont.

Robert Goldstein, Chairman and Chief Executive Officer of Las Vegas Sands, said: “With its opening in 2010, our founder Sheldon G. Adelson embarked on a journey in Singapore with Marina Bay Sands and the people of Singapore that promised to change the face of tourism in the region. Fifteen years later, we have delivered on these ambitions and more. Marina Bay Sands is the world’s most successful integrated resort in history, and the gold standard in the industry. It has been truly incredible to witness Mr Adelson’s vision come to life, and we are proud to carry his legacy forward with today’s groundbreaking ceremony for our new development here. We have every intention of delivering a product that will be the envy of the hospitality industry and ushers in a new era of luxury tourism in Singapore.”

When completed, the new development is set to redefine industry standards further and push boundaries in the realms of luxury tourism, hospitality and entertainment, curating the finest and most exclusive suite of experiences for travellers.

The pioneering project will feature a soaring 570-suite luxury hotel tower capped with signature rooftop and dining experiences, luxury retail boutiques, gaming, holistic spa and wellness amenities, and approximately 200,000 square feet of premium meeting space.  Proving to be another extraordinary feat of engineering, the new property is being designed by Safdie Architects.

Situated adjacent to the hotel tower, is the podium that will serve as a bustling hotspot for business, entertainment and cultural exchange. At its core is the state-of-the-art arena. The purpose-built arena situated against the stunning backdrop of Marina Bay aims to enhance the live entertainment scene in Asia, and is being designed by Populous.

The arena will be integrated with new and existing developments within the Marina Bay precinct for greater efficiency and pedestrian connectivity, providing direct access to Bayfront MRT station and linkways between Marina Bay and Gardens by the Bay.

Senior Principal and Head of Populous’ Singapore Studio Andrew Tulen, and Founding Partner of Safdie Architects Moshe Safdie helped to officiate the groundbreaking ceremony where more than 220 guests saw Marina Bay Sands illuminated in a wash of golden hues.
